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 003 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.265(c)(4)(iv): Elevated walks. All elevated walks, runways, or platforms, if 4 feet or more from the floor level, shall be provided with a standard railing except on loading or unloading sides of platforms. If height exceeds 6 feet, a standard toe board also shall be provided to prevent material from rolling or falling off. (a) Employees working on the debarker were exposed to fall hazards of approximately 78 inches or more while greasing, lubricating, oiling, and performing servicing and maintenance work. Employees accessed the debarker and worked off a platform and elevated walk while exposed to the fall hazards with no form of fall protection. (b) A catwalk over the head saw pit utilized to access the McDONOUGH head saw and carriage was not provided standard toe boards when over 6 feet in height with materials stored on the catwalk exposing employees below to potential struck by hazards.
